Restaurant Palægade is a culinary landmark in the heart of Copenhagen, renowned for its masterfully crafted smørrebrød – the Danish open‑faced sandwich – as well as a sophisticated evening menu that blends classic Danish flavors with French-inspired techniques. Open daily from 11:30 am to 5:00 pm for lunch and 6:30 pm to midnight for dinner, the restaurant offers a relaxed yet elegant setting that appeals to both locals and visitors. The concept was born in 2016 with the ambition to provide the “best smørrebrød in Denmark,” a promise that has been consistently upheld through meticulous house‑made ingredients, from rye bread baked in‑house to hand‑crafted remoulade and seasonal produce sourced from local farms. The dinner service continues this culinary philosophy, featuring a diverse menu that ranges from caviar and truffle to inventive vegetarian dishes such as “Fuglekvidder” – cauliflower‑based rolls served on rye. Wine connoisseurs will appreciate the extensive, carefully curated wine list, while beer lovers can indulge in a selection of local craft brews. Palægade’s signature dessert trolley, a dark walnut carriage that delivers pastries and petits fours right to your table, adds an extra touch of charm to the dining experience. Located just a stone’s throw from Amalienborg Castle, Nyhavn, and the iconic Hotel D’Angleterre, Palægade offers a perfect backdrop for both casual lunches and celebratory dinners, making it a must‑visit destination for food enthusiasts seeking authentic Danish cuisine with a modern twist.
